Transaction ca804869dcee9779f94ee664c7307f1e6bf043c530dbcc7f8a0177a20deaa430

1 Input
2 Outputs
  • ca804869dcee9779f94ee664c7307f1e6bf043c530dbcc7f8a0177a20deaa430:0
  • value  22299983193
    address  32kyS7R7nd4eDoVSgfuiM5mCUiRGgfYNqb
  • ca804869dcee9779f94ee664c7307f1e6bf043c530dbcc7f8a0177a20deaa430:1
  • value  260000000
    address  3K9dUAFBMdybxxzwKNofR4qAWutCgS8FaS